Augustin Perret, Le Locle, Swiss, made for the Spanish Market, circa 1860. Fine 18 ct. gold, quarter repeating, "grande et petite sonnerie" clock-watch.
C. Three body, "pommes et filets" with engineturned band and flat back. D. Silver engine-turned with Roman numerals and sunk subsidiary seconds, centre and border with gold cast floral and foliate decoration. Blued steel "spade" hands. M. Glazed 22"', frosted and gilt, 32 jewels, double train with going barrels, lateral lever escapement, plain steel three-arm balance with flat balance spring and regulator. Striking and repeating on gongs with visible work, button in the band and strike/silent and grande/petite sonnerie levers in the bezel. Signed beneath the gongs on the front plate. In very good condition. Diam. 57 mm.
